A witty novel of coming of age during wartime in America, the Confession is a "comical historical pastoral" that chronicles the struggles of growing up the son of a Midwestern bishop. Samuel escapes Missouri to attend Harvard, where he gets himself expelled for exploding a footbridge over the Charles River. He is soon sent to fight in Korea and lands in a prison camp. Samuel's picaresque coming of age--by turns both funny and poignant--is truly the tale of "a child of the century."
